Buharin, Zamfara’s most wanted bandit killed

Zamfara State’s most wanted bandit Buharin Daji has been killed by colleagues in the bushes of Dansadau. Zamfara Deputy Governor, Alhaji Ibrahim Wakkala, confirmed this on Friday while displaying the dead body of the “most notorious armed bandit” on security wanted list in the state. Zamfara State: Teacher flogs student to death

A teacher at Government Day Secondary School Sankalawa in Bungudu Local Government Area of Zamfara has allegedly flogged a student to death. The incident was revealed on Wednesday by Alhaji Muhammad Abubakar-Gummi, Deputy Speaker of the State House of Assembly.
